Dr. Alexander Carrese, DO is a Physical Medicine and Rehabilitation Physician with a focus on Interventional Spine, Musculoskeletal, Pain and Electrodiagnostic Medicine.
Dr. Carrese has a true passion for rehabilitation medicine and restoring movement and function to his patients in order to help with daily activities. He plans to take a multimodal approach to treating patients with his primary focus on spine and musculoskeletal treatments. He is also well trained in Electrodiagnostic medicine (EDX) that will help aid in the diagnosis and treatment of many conditions. During residency training, he spent one month at the University of Lusaka in Zambia, Africa training other individuals in EDX studies as well as treating the local community.
Dr. Carrese grew up in the New Haven, CT area and is excited to return home. He completed his Bachelors of Science from Union College (Schenectady, NY) in 2008. He earned his Doctor of Osteopathic Medicine Degree from Campbell University School of Osteopathic Medicine (Buies Creek, NC) in 2017.
He then completed his residency in Physical Medicine and Rehabilitation from Michigan State University in 2021 where he served as Chief Resident (2020-2021). He is currently completing a Fellowship in Interventional Spine, Musculoskeletal and Pain Medicine at Comprehensive Pain Specialists-Michigan State University in Flint, MI. In his free time, Dr. Carrese loves to spend time with family, watch sports, exercise, spend time at the beach surfing and cooking.
